21332-86-5,213329-45-4,21333-16-4,21333-23-3,213333-70-1,213338-89-7 Supplier | SOURCINGCHEMICALS.COM
CMO CDMO service. SOURCINGCHEMICALS.COM supply 21332-86-5,213329-45-4,21333-16-4,21333-23-3,213333-70-1,213338-89-7 and related compounds.
21333-16-4 213333-70-1 21333-23-3 213329-45-4 213338-89-7 21332-86-5